Description
Katana Piles 80kN, 100kN & 150kN Series (Katana piles) are steel screw piles with capacities of 80kN, 100kN & 150kN utilising a proprietary designed screw thread and cutting comb.
Katana piles are available in lengths of 1 to 4 metres, with extension, connector and capping accessories available.
Scope
Katana piles are used to transfer the building loads from the building structure down to a suitable bearing stratum below ground surface.
Katana piles are often used to support concrete slabs on ground. Common reasons for specifying screw piles are very large design loads, poor soil conditions at shallow depth, or site constraints like property lines.
The placement and size of piles is dependent on the engineering design and geotechnical information for each site.
